Define Project Objectives in Real Estate
In real estate, defining project objectives is a pivotal step that sets the tone for the entire endeavor. It involves clearly articulating the desired outcomes and results of a development or investment initiative. This process begins with understanding the market dynamics, identifying target demographics, and assessing the competitive landscape. By setting specific goals, such as constructing sustainable residential buildings or revitalizing underutilized urban spaces, stakeholders gain a shared vision.
Well-defined objectives for real estate projects enable better planning and resource allocation. They guide decision-making processes, ensuring that every action aligns with the overarching strategy. For instance, if the objective is to create mixed-use properties, timelines and budgets can be allocated accordingly, incorporating aspects like design, construction, and marketing. This strategic approach fosters efficiency, helps manage expectations, and ultimately contributes to successful project completion in a competitive real estate market.
Break Down Tasks for Timely Completion
In the dynamic realm of Real Estate, establishing a clear scope and timeline is paramount for project success. To achieve this, breaking down tasks into manageable chunks is essential. This not only enhances efficiency but also ensures timely completion of each phase. By dissecting complex projects into smaller, defined tasks, agents and developers can allocate resources effectively, set realistic deadlines, and track progress seamlessly.
This strategic approach allows for a structured flow from initial planning to final execution. Each task has a designated place in the timeline, fostering accountability and minimizing delays. Whether it’s marketing preparation, construction milestones, or legal paperwork, a well-defined scope ensures every element contributes to the overall project goal, ultimately streamlining the real estate process.
Set Realistic Deadlines and Milestones
In the realm of real estate, setting clear timelines is paramount for project success. To ensure every stakeholder is on the same page, establish well-defined milestones and deadlines. These should be realistic, accounting for potential challenges and resource availability. By setting achievable targets, you foster a culture of accountability and productivity. Incorporating these markers into your project plan facilitates efficient progress tracking, enabling quick adjustments when necessary.
Realistic deadlines also ensure that the end goal remains focused and tangible. They provide a roadmap for all involved, guiding their efforts and decisions. In the dynamic landscape of real estate, where opportunities and obstacles can arise unexpectedly, adhering to set milestones keeps projects on course, ultimately enhancing overall success rates.
